Все индикаторы
Эксклюзив

Oscillator Matrix

Статистический осцилляторный индикатор для TradingView, который определяет динамические зоны перекупленности и перепроданности на основе фактического распределения частоты разворотов.

📅 Добавлен October 1, 2024·🏷️ 3 тегов·⏱️ 6 мин. чтения

Обзор

FibAlgo - Oscillator Matrix — это индикатор статистического анализа осцилляторов, который определяет динамические зоны перекупленности и перепроданности, анализируя, где исторически происходили ценовые пики относительно значений осциллятора. Вместо использования фиксированных порогов (например, RSI 70/30) он рассчитывает зоны на основе данных, опираясь на фактическое распределение частоты появления пиков.

Индикатор поддерживает шесть типов осцилляторов (RSI, MFI, Momentum, Stochastic, Stochastic RSI, Chaikin Money Flow), применяет опциональное взвешивание с затуханием данных для учета недавнего поведения рынка и отображает расширенную таблицу анализа с показателями уверенности и метриками эффективности.

Oscillator Matrix - Overview on TradingView

Динамические зоны на основе частоты

Традиционный анализ осцилляторов использует фиксированные пороги — например, RSI выше 70 считается зоной перекупленности. Этот индикатор использует другой подход: он исследует, где на шкале осциллятора фактически происходили ценовые пики (PH) и впадины (PL), группирует эти значения в диапазоны по 5 пунктов (например, "75-80", "80-85") и определяет, в каком диапазоне наблюдается наибольшая взвешенная частота. В результате формируется пара динамических полос, которые смещаются по мере изменения поведения рынка.

Взвешивание с затуханием данных

При включении система присваивает экспоненциально убывающие веса более старым пикам. Это означает, что недавнее поведение пиков оказывает большее влияние на расчет зон, чем старые данные. Скорость затухания (по умолчанию: 0.95) контролирует, насколько сильно учитываются недавние данные. Значение, близкое к 1.0, обрабатывает все данные почти одинаково; более низкие значения сильнее подчеркивают недавние пики.

Анализ эффективности

Для каждой категории осциллятора, в которой произошел пик, индикатор измеряет, что произошло дальше: насколько далеко цена переместилась после пика (Среднее падение% для пиков, Средний рост% для впадин) и за сколько баров был достигнут этот экстремум (Среднее время). Это дает контекст, выходящий за рамки простой частоты — зона может быть частой, но приводить лишь к небольшим последующим движениям, или редкой, но связанной с более значительными изменениями цены.

Oscillator Matrix - Performance Analysis on TradingView

Шаг 1 — Обнаружение пиков

Алгоритм зигзага обнаруживает ценовые пики (PH) и впадины (PL), используя настраиваемый период (по умолчанию: 21 бар). Каждый подтвержденный пик фиксирует значение осциллятора на этом баре.

Шаг 2 — Распределение по категориям

Значения осциллятора в точках пиков группируются в категории по 5 пунктов (0-5, 5-10, ... 95-100). Для осцилляторов без границ (Momentum, CMF) значения сначала нормализуются к шкале 0-100. Каждая категория накапливает взвешенное количество на основе того, сколько пиков попало в этот диапазон.

Шаг 3 — Определение моды

Категория с наибольшим взвешенным количеством становится "модой" — наиболее частым диапазоном осциллятора для данного типа пика. Мода PH определяет верхнюю (бордовую) полосу, а мода PL определяет нижнюю (бирюзовую) полосу. Эти полосы динамически обновляются по мере формирования новых пиков.

Шаг 4 — Измерение эффективности

Когда анализ эффективности включен, индикатор смотрит вперед от каждого исторического пика (до настраиваемого количества баров) и записывает максимальное изменение цены и время. Эти значения усредняются по категориям и отображаются в таблице анализа.

Шаг 5 — Визуализация

Значение осциллятора отображается в виде основной линии. Две динамические полосы рисуются как закрашенные области. Динамическая средняя полоса (среднее значение центров верхней и нижней полос) служит нейтральным ориентиром. Опциональная таблица анализа отображает полную статистическую разбивку.

Oscillator Matrix - Step 5 — Visualization on TradingView
Oscillator Matrix - Step 5 — Visualization on TradingView

Шесть типов осцилляторов

  • RSI — С опциональным сглаживанием (SMA, EMA, RMA, WMA, VWMA) и наложением полос Боллинджера.
  • MFI — Индекс денежного потока для взвешенного по объему импульса.
  • Momentum — Автоматически нормализуется к шкале 0-100.
  • Stochastic — С настраиваемым сглаживанием %K и опциональной линией %D.
  • Stochastic RSI — С настраиваемым сглаживанием %K и опциональной линией %D.
  • Chaikin Money Flow — Автоматически нормализуется из шкалы -1/+1 в шкалу 0-100.

Адаптивные частотные полосы

  • Бордовая полоса отмечает диапазон осциллятора, в котором ценовые пики происходят наиболее часто.
  • Бирюзовая полоса отмечает диапазон осциллятора, в котором ценовые впадины происходят наиболее часто.
  • Полосы смещаются автоматически по мере накопления новых данных о пиках.
  • Опциональное затухание данных придает больший вес недавним пикам.

Расширенная таблица анализа

  • Параллельная статистическая разбивка для PH и PL.
  • Столбцы: Зона, Количество, Уверенность%, Средняя эффективность% и Среднее время.
  • Зона с наибольшей частотой выделена желтым цветом.
  • Четыре варианта размера таблицы (Крошечная, Маленькая, Обычная, Большая).

Опции сглаживания RSI

  • Шесть методов сглаживания: SMA, SMA + Полосы Боллинджера, EMA, SMMA (RMA), WMA, VWMA.
  • Наложение полос Боллинджера с настраиваемым стандартным отклонением.
  • Сглаживание можно включать или отключать независимо.

Система оповещений

  • Вход в зону пиков — срабатывает, когда осциллятор входит в бордовую полосу.
  • Выход из зоны пиков — срабатывает, когда осциллятор покидает бордовую полосу.
  • Вход в зону впадин — срабатывает, когда осциллятор входит в бирюзовую полосу.
  • Выход из зоны впадин — срабатывает, когда осциллятор покидает бирюзовую полосу.
  • Пересечение средней полосы вверх / вниз — срабатывает при пересечении динамической средней полосы.
  • Смещение уровня полос — срабатывает, когда категория моды изменяется и полосы перемещаются на новый уровень.
  • Каждый тип оповещения можно включать/выключать индивидуально. Сообщения включают тикер, таймфрейм, тип осциллятора и текущее значение.
Oscillator Matrix - Alert System on TradingView
Oscillator Matrix - Alert System on TradingView
Oscillator Matrix - Alert System on TradingView
Oscillator Matrix - Alert System on TradingView
Oscillator Matrix - Alert System on TradingView

Начало работы

Добавьте индикатор на любой график. Настройки по умолчанию (RSI, Период: 21, Глубина анализа: 100 пиков, Затухание включено) хорошо работают для большинства ликвидных инструментов на таймфреймах от 1H до 4H.

Чтение графика

  • Бирюзовая линия = Текущее значение осциллятора.
  • Закрашенная бордовая область = Зона пиков — диапазон осциллятора, в котором ценовые пики происходили наиболее часто.
  • Закрашенная бирюзовая область = Зона впадин — диапазон осциллятора, в котором ценовые впадины происходили наиболее часто.
  • Серые пунктирные круги = Динамическая средняя полоса (среднее значение центров зон пиков и впадин).
  • Желтая строка в таблице = Категория с наибольшей частотой для данного типа пика.

Ключевые параметры

  • Период PH/PL (2–200): Контролирует чувствительность зигзага. Более высокие значения обнаруживают более крупные колебания.
  • Глубина анализа пиков (10–500): Сколько исторических пиков включать в анализ.
  • Включить затухание данных: При включении недавние пики получают больший вес.
  • Скорость затухания (0.1–1.0): Контролирует, насколько сильно учитываются недавние данные.
  • Баров для проверки эффективности (5–100): Насколько далеко вперед измерять движение цены после каждого пика.

Предлагаемый рабочий процесс

1. Наблюдайте, где находится линия осциллятора относительно бордовой и бирюзовой полос.

2. Когда осциллятор входит в бордовую полосу, обратите внимание, что ценовые пики исторически происходили в этом диапазоне. 3. Когда осциллятор входит в бирюзовую полосу, обратите внимание, что ценовые впадины исторически происходили в этом диапазоне. 4. Включите таблицу анализа, чтобы изучить проценты уверенности и среднюю эффективность для каждой зоны. 5. Используйте метрики эффективности (Среднее падение%, Средний рост%, Среднее время) в качестве дополнительного контекста при оценке потенциальных ситуаций для входа.
  • Этот индикатор является инструментом технического анализа, а не торговой системой. Он не генерирует ордера на покупку/продажу.
  • Частота зон основана на исторических данных о пиках. Прошлые взаимосвязи осциллятора и пиков не гарантируют будущего поведения.
  • Для анализа требуется минимальное количество пиков для получения значимой статистики. По новым инструментам или на очень низких таймфреймах результаты могут быть ненадежными, пока не накопится достаточное количество данных.
  • Взвешивание с затуханием данных может вызывать быстрое смещение зон в периоды изменения структуры рынка, особенно при низких значениях скорости затухания.
  • Нормализация Momentum и CMF использует окно анализа в 500 баров. Экстремальные значения за пределами этого окна могут влиять на шкалу нормализации.
  • Анализ эффективности измеряет максимальное изменение цены в пределах фиксированного окна вперед. Фактические результаты зависят от критериев выхода трейдера и не учитываются этим измерением.

Расчеты осцилляторов (RSI, MFI, Stochastic, Stochastic RSI, Chaikin Money Flow) основаны на их соответствующих общепризнанных формулах. Система динамических зон на основе частоты, взвешенный анализ категорий, механизм измерения эффективности и таблица анализа являются оригинальными разработками.

Теги
#Oscillators#Statistical#Signals

Часто задаваемые вопросы

Что такое индикатор Oscillator Matrix?
Статистический осцилляторный индикатор для TradingView, который определяет динамические зоны перекупленности и перепроданности на основе фактического распределения частоты разворотов.
Бесплатен ли Oscillator Matrix для использования на TradingView?
Oscillator Matrix — это премиум-индикатор, включённый в подписку FibAlgo. Посетите fibalgo.com для получения информации о ценах.
Как добавить Oscillator Matrix на мой график TradingView?
Подпишитесь на FibAlgo, затем найдите "Oscillator Matrix" в панели индикаторов TradingView. После привязки вашего аккаунта индикатор станет доступен в ваших скриптах по приглашению.
Какие торговые стратегии лучше всего работают с Oscillator Matrix?
Oscillator Matrix обычно используется для анализа oscillators, statistical, signals. Он хорошо работает как часть стратегии подтверждения с несколькими индикаторами на любом таймфрейме.

Разблокируйте эксклюзивные инструменты FibAlgo

Лучшие торговые индикаторы и AI-анализ для продвинутой торговли.

Разблокировать

Ещё из серии FibAlgo

Смотреть все
Adaptive Deviation Channels

Adaptive Deviation Channels

Индикатор TradingView, который создает динамические зоны поддержки и сопротивления, анализируя исторические отклонения точек разворота от центральной скользящей средней.

Perfect Entry ZoneЭксклюзив

Perfect Entry Zone

Адаптивный индикатор на основе Фибоначчи для TradingView, который определяет повторяющиеся зоны коррекции и проецирует временные зоны Фибоначчи.

Perfect Retracement ZoneЭксклюзив

Perfect Retracement Zone

Динамический индикатор коррекции Фибоначчи для TradingView, который определяет статистически значимые зоны поддержки и сопротивления с помощью анализа частоты разворотов.

Screener (PEZ)Эксклюзив

Screener (PEZ)

Мультисимвольный скринер TradingView, который одновременно отслеживает до 10 символов с позициями в диапазоне Фибоначчи, направлением тренда и статусом зон.